+#ifndef __F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_T__
+#define __F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_T__
+
+#include <vnet/fib/fib_node.h>
+
+/**
+ * Delegate types
+ */
+typedef enum fib_entry_delegate_type_t_ {
+    /**
+     * Forwarding chain types:
+     * for the vast majority of FIB entries only one chain is required - the
+     * one that forwards traffic matching the fib_entry_t's fib_prefix_t. For those
+     * fib_entry_t that are a resolution target for other fib_entry_t's they will also
+     * need the chain to provide forwarding for those children. We store these additional
+     * chains in delegates to save memory in the common case.
+     */
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_UNICAST_IP4 = FIB_FORW_CHAIN_TYPE_UNICAST_IP4,
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_UNICAST_IP6 = FIB_FORW_CHAIN_TYPE_UNICAST_IP6,
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_MPLS_EOS = FIB_FORW_CHAIN_TYPE_MPLS_EOS,
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_MPLS_NON_EOS = FIB_FORW_CHAIN_TYPE_MPLS_NON_EOS,
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_ETHERNET = FIB_FORW_CHAIN_TYPE_ETHERNET,
+    /**
+     * Dependency list of covered entries.
+     * these are more specific entries that are interested in changes
+     * to their respective cover
+     */
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_COVERED,
+    /**
+     * Attached import/export functionality
+     */
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_ATTACHED_IMPORT,
+    F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_ATTACHED_EXPORT,
+} fib_entry_delegate_type_t;
+
+#define FOR_EACH_DELEGATE_CHAIN(_entry, _fdt, _fed, _body)    \
+{                                                             \
+    for (_fdt = F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_UNICAST_IP4;         \
+         _fdt <= FIB_ENTRY_DELEGATE_CHAIN_ETHERNET;           \
+         _fdt++)                                              \
+    {                                                         \
+        _fed = fib_entry_delegate_get(_entry, _fdt);          \
+        if (NULL != _fed) {                                   \
+            _body;                                            \
+        }                                                     \
+    }                                                         \
+}
+
+/**
+ * A Delagate is a means to implmenet the Delagation design pattern; the extension of an
+ * objects functionality through the composition of, and delgation to, other objects.
+ * These 'other' objects are delegates. Delagates are thus attached to other FIB objects
+ * to extend their functionality.
+ */
+typedef struct fib_entry_delegate_t_
+{
+    /**
+     * The FIB entry object to which the delagate is attached
+     */
+    fib_node_index_t fd_entry_index;
+
+    /**
+     * The delagate type
+     */
+    fib_entry_delegate_type_t fd_type;
+
+    /**
+     * A union of data for the different delegate types
+     * These delegates are stored in a sparse vector on the entry, so they
+     * must all be of the same size. We could use indirection here for all types,
+     * i.e. store an index, that's ok for large delegates, like the attached export
+     * but for the chain delegates it's excessive
+     */
+    union
+    {
+        /**
+         * Valid for the forwarding chain delegates. The LB that is built.
+         */
+        dpo_id_t fd_dpo;
+
+        /**
+         * Valid for the attached import cases. An index of the importer/exporter
+         */
+        fib_node_index_t fd_index;
+
+        /**
+         * For the cover tracking. The node list;
+         */
+        fib_node_list_t fd_list;
+    };
+} fib_entry_delegate_t;
+
+struct fib_entry_t_;
+
+extern void fib_entry_delegate_remove(struct fib_entry_t_ *fib_entry,
+                                      fib_entry_delegate_type_t type);
+
+extern fib_entry_delegate_t *fib_entry_delegate_find_or_add(struct fib_entry_t_ *fib_entry,
+                                                            fib_entry_delegate_type_t fdt);
+extern fib_entry_delegate_t *fib_entry_delegate_get(const struct fib_entry_t_ *fib_entry,
+                                                    fib_entry_delegate_type_t type);
+
+extern fib_forward_chain_type_t fib_entry_delegate_type_to_chain_type(
+    fib_entry_delegate_type_t type);
+
+extern fib_entry_delegate_type_t fib_entry_chain_type_to_delegate_type(
+     fib_forward_chain_type_t type);
+
+#endif
